1. What is Panda Fest?
Panda Fest is a rapidly growing, multi-city outdoor Asian food & culture festival that blends food, art, performance, and immersive experiences—all with a touch of panda magic. Founded by BiuBiu Xu (creator of NYC’s Dragon Fest), it has already sold out events in cities like Boston, Seattle, Philadelphia, and Atlanta. (Panda festival)
The festival brings together:
- Hundreds of authentic street food offerings from across Asia
- Live cultural performances: traditional dances, K-Pop, lion dance, etc.
- Merch markets & artisans making crafts, clothing, art, specialty items
- Panda-themed fun: inflatable pandas, bounce houses, panda shaped treats, photo ops
- Inclusive perks like free gifts, VIP extras, pet/pet owner provisions, family friendliness.
Panda Fest is designed for all ages, cultures, and interests—whether you’re a food explorer, culture enthusiast, or just want a fun weekend out.
2. Panda Fest Nashville 2025: Dates, Venue & Highlights
Dates & Venue
- When: October 24-26, 2025 (Panda festival)
- Where: Fair Park, 2300 Bransford Ave, Nashville, TN (Panda festival)
Hours
| Day | Time |
|---|---|
| Friday | 4:00 PM – 10:00 PM |
| Saturday | 10:00 AM – 10:00 PM |
| Sunday | 10:00 AM – 8:00 PM |
What You’ll Experience
- 80+ Asian food vendors serving 250+ authentic street food dishes from all over Asia—from dumplings, ramen, sushi, skewers to sweets like bubble tea and shaved ice. (Panda festival)
- 20+ merchandise vendors with artisan goods, clothing, crafts inspired by Asian traditions. (Panda festival)
- Live performances including traditional Asian dance, modern routines like K-Pop, plus likely lion dances and more. (Panda festival)
- Panda-theme installations & fun: A 15-foot inflatable panda (or giant inflatable panda), panda bounce house, thematic photo opportunities, panda-inspired treats & merchandise. (Panda festival)
3. Panda Fest Dallas 2025: Debut Details & What to Expect
Dates & Venue
- When: November 7-9, 2025 (Secret Dallas)
- Where: Carpenter Park, Downtown Dallas, 2201 Pacific Ave, Dallas, TX 75201 (Secret Dallas)
What’s New & Special in Dallas
- Dallas will be one of the first times Panda Fest hits Texas, so there’s some novelty and excitement built in. (Secret Dallas)
- Expect over 65 food vendors and 150+ Asian dishes spanning many Asian cuisines: Chinese, Korean, Thai, Japanese, etc. (Secret Dallas)
- Similar cultural & arts market — heritage goods, artisanal teas, crafts, calligraphy, jewelry. (Secret Dallas)
- Live performance lineup will include lion dance, K-Pop showcases, and more. (Secret Dallas)
- Panda-themes: large inflatable panda, panda-shaped desserts, panda-themed packaging; all designed for fun & photo moments. (Secret Dallas)

6. Tickets & Pricing: General Admission, VIP & Early Bird
Here’s a breakdown of the ticket structure and perks for Nashville and Dallas.
Nashville Ticket Pricing & Perks
| Ticket Type | Price Details | Free Gifts / Perks |
|---|---|---|
| Early Bird | $10 (limited, selected time slots) through Sept 14, 2025 | Included: 2 free gifts (custom Panda Fest pin featuring Nashville + panda headband). (Panda festival) |
| General Admission | $14, Saturdays $16 (slightly higher) | Includes GA benefits + above gifts. Single entry for selected time slot. (Panda festival) |
| VIP | $35 | All GA benefits + one more gift bag (worth more), fast-pass entrance, access to VIP bars/lounges/bathrooms. (Panda festival) |
| Gate Admission | $20 (on-site, subject to availability) | Guaranteed entry (if capacity allows) but no early-bird savings. (Panda festival) |
Dallas Ticketing
- Early Bird tickets go on sale September 17, 2025 starting at $10. (Secret Dallas)
- General Admission starts at $14, Saturday’s ticket price maybe a bit higher. Gate tickets will be around $20. (Secret Dallas)
- Kids under 6 are typically free. Free gifts included with many tickets. (Secret Dallas)

9. FAQs
Q: Is the event rain or shine?
A: Yes — Panda Fest is a rain-or-shine event unless severe weather forces postponement or cancellation. (Panda festival)
Q: Can I buy tickets at the gate?
A: Yes — Gate admission for Nashville is $20. But early purchase is recommended, since entry is subject to capacity limits. (Panda festival)
Q: Are tickets refundable or transferable?
A: Tickets are non-refundable. Also not transferable to other dates or time slots. (Panda festival)
Q: Are there vegetarian / vegan or dietary-restricted options?
A: Yes — many vendors offer vegetarian or vegan options. (Panda festival)
Q: Can I bring outside food / beverage?
A: No — outside food or beverages are generally prohibited. (Panda festival)
Q: Pets allowed?
A: Dogs on a leash are allowed, with requirements like vaccinations, tags, good behavior. Owner must clean up and keep pets away from food vendors. (Panda festival)
